-The media seems to have just found out there was possibly a live round in the revolver! Really? Kinda figured that out on Day 1. ATF says it was a live round that passed through her striking the director standing behind her. A wad from a blank would not make it that far.

-Baldwin says he was doing a cross draw when the round went off? Haven't seen a map of just where she was standing but I would think near the camera would be her 'place'. Cameras had ballistic sheilds but people did not. A cross draw might take up to a 90 movement of the barrel. I'm betting he had his finger on the trigger the whole time.

- Using a pistol designated for use in the movie to use for target practice? Just a stupid move. That's how accidents happen. Bring your own!

-Obviously the armorer lost control of her job. She should have been the one to clear, load and hand out every weapon every day. Definitely seems to have been out of her depth. The director should not have been the one to hand them out. He claimed it was a COLD weapon. How did he know? Did he clear it and load in the blanks? I doubt it.

In my personal experience, after brand-new-to-firearms persons, at times it's among those that are most confident in their experience that can become complacent with gun safety.

When not at the range (and immediately before a person is going to engage in target practice downrange), whenever I'm presenting a firearm to simply show anyone(regardless of level of experience); it is ALWAYS with:

1. mag removed/tube cleared.
2. the chamber cleared.
3. slide locked/bolt back or cylinder cleared and open.

It is then, and only then; that I will present the firearm showing the recipient and getting acknowledgment that the firearm is clear before passing it off. There have been times that I get some 'eye rolls' from long-time firearms owners for this seemingly over-redundant practice.

I, and would like to believe that most on here, give gun safety the seriousness that it deserves at ALL times.
